General Description |
Sodium trifluoromethanesulfonate (Sodium triflate or NaOTf) is an efficient catalyst as well as a reagent in many organic reactions. The prominent application includes catalytic asymmetric Mannich-type reactions, Mannich-type reactions in water, and Diels-Alder reactions. |
